    • HEARING SYSTEM, METHOD FOR OPERATING A HEARING SYSTEM, AND HEARING SYSTEM NETWORK

    • The method for operating a hearing system (1) comprises using a network identifier for identifying messages (9) within a network formed by devices (11, 12, 13, 14) of said hearing system (1). Through this, an improved message management can be achieved. Typically, the network identifier will be used for marking messages (9) as messages (9) within the network (10) and for recognizing messages (9) as messages (9) within the network (10). A device (11; 12; 13; 14) of a hearing system (1) is configured to participate in a network (10), comprises a storage unit (4) in which a network identifier is stored, and is configured to use said network identifier for identifying messages (9) within said network. Messages (9) in the network can comprise, in addition to the network identifier, complementing data, wherein the treatment of further contents of a received message depends on the result of an evaluation of the complementing data.

    • HEARING SYSTEM AND METHOD FOR OPERATING THE SAME

    • The method for operating a hearing system comprises the steps of a) requesting (300) said hearing system to execute a functionality; and b) deciding (400) whether or not to execute the requested functionality. It preferably comprises the steps of c) checking (440) the current availability of the requested functionality; wherein the decision of step b) depends on the so-obtained current availability of the requested functionality, and d) executing the requested functionality, only if the requested functionality is currently available in said hearing system. The hearing system comprises at least one decision unit adapted to deciding whether or not to execute functionalities the hearing system is requested to execute.The invention can make it possible to form hearing systems from a wide range of devices.

    • Methods for operating a hearing device as well as hearing devices

    • Method for operating a hearing device (1) that is worn by a hearing device user (2), the method comprising the steps of receiving a transmission signal (4) comprising an audio signal (4) of a sound sources (S), determining a distance (d) between the sound source (S) and the hearing device (1), and generating an output signal supplied to an output transducer (8) of the hearing device (1) by at least taking into account the audio signal (4) of the transmission signal (3) and the distance (d). Further embodiments are directed to determining an angle (α) defined by a sagittal plane (5) of the hearing device user (2) and a line drawn between the hearing device (1) and the sound source (S). The angle (α) is additionally used to generate the output signal supplied to the output transducer (8) of the hearing device (1).

    • METHOD FOR OPERATING A HEARING DEVICE AS WELL AS A HEARING DEVICE

    • A method for operating a hearing device worn by a hearing device user. The method includes picking up an audio signal (a) by an input transducer of the hearing device. The audio signal (a) includes a source signal (s) of a sound source (SS) and a disturbing signal (d) of a disturbing source (DS). The method also includes receiving a transmission signal (d_AIS) via an interface unit of the hearing device. The transmission signal (d_AIS) includes the disturbing signal (d) or at least characteristic features of the disturbing signal (d). The method also includes at least partially eliminating the disturbing signal (d) from the audio signal (a) by using the disturbing signal (d) transmitted by the transmission signal (d_AIS) or by using the characteristic features of the disturbing signal (d) transmitted by the transmission signal (d_AIS) for obtaining an adjusted audio signal (a*), and processing the adjusted audio signal (a*).

    • Hearing system with joint task scheduling

    • The hearing system (1) comprises a first processing unit (2A); a second processing unit (2B); and a scheduling unit (3) for jointly scheduling tasks to be executed in said first processing unit (2A) and tasks to be executed in said second processing unit (2B). Preferably, the hearing system (1) comprises a first device (1A) comprising said first processing unit (2A); and a second device (1B) comprising said second processing unit (2B).The method for operating a hearing system (1) comprising a first (2A) and a second (2B) processing unit, comprises the step of jointly scheduling at least one task to be executed in said first processing unit (2A) and at least one task to be executed in said second processing unit (2B). If, during scheduling of a task to be executed in said first processing unit, tasks to be executed in said second processing unit can be considered, an improved performance of the hearing system (1) can be achieved, e.g, an improved time synchronization or an improved handling of obsolete tasks.

    • Synchronization of sound generated in binaural hearing system

    • The binaural hearing system comprises a first hearing device and a second hearing device, each comprising an output transducer for converting audio signals into signals to be perceived by a user of the hearing system. A communication link interconnects the first and second hearing devices. A sound generator comprised in the first hearing device generates first audio signals. The first hearing device is adapted to transmit the first audio signals to the second hearing device via the communication link. Through the transmission of the generated first audio signals, it is possible to achieve a predictable latency for the perception of the first audio signals by the user's two ears.
